## Releases

Webhooks from Quillgate retry on 5xx with exponential backoff: 1s base, factor 2, max 6 attempts, then dead-lettered to the `qx-failed` queue. 4xx responses are never retried. Duplicate delivery is possible; consumers must be idempotent on event ID. Release artifacts are published only after CI verifies the payload against the signing key below.

deploy key for kajof-fajop: bky6_gDHw9Q

Welcome to on-call for the Larkspun crash-report pipeline. Crashes from the Pebblewing mobile app land in the Tidemark intake queue, get symbolicated by the Ossify workers, and surface in the Glasshouse dashboard. If symbolication stalls, first check Ossify worker health, then requeue from Tidemark. To query the intake service directly during an incident, authenticate with the internal key that follows.

API key for fahip-kahip: zpat23_XiJGUHz5xfaAtaIqUkus0rh

## Alert: StatRelay Sidecar Flush Lag

This alert fires when the StatRelay metrics-aggregation sidecar falls more than 120 seconds behind on flushing buffered samples to the Coalmine backend. Plugin-emitted counters are buffered in-process, so sustained lag usually means a plugin is emitting unbounded label cardinality or blocking the flush thread. Check your plugin's metric registration against the published cardinality limits before escalating. If the lag persists after your plugin is ruled out, contact the telemetry team.

escalation mailbox, bagug-fahof: novdor.wendor.jormir@norvalabs.example